Education System in Australia

The Australian education system consists of universities (public, overseas and private), TAFE (Technical and Further Education) providers and private education providers like the PTE.

  • Universities : public, private and overseas (Australia has 43 universities: 40 public, 2 overseas and 1 private)
  • Private Universities : All Australian states and territories have their PTEs.
  • TAFE : Technical and Further Education (parallel to Polytechnics in India and Community Colleges in Australia).

Study Programs :

Degree Average fees (AUD)
UG AUD 20,000 - 45,000
PG AUD 22,000 - 50,000
PhD AUD 18,000 - 42,000
Diploma AUD 26,000 - 30,000

Intakes :

  • Semester/ Trimester 1 : Starts late February/early March to late May/early June
  • Semester/ Trimester 2 : Starts late July/early August
  • Semester/ Trimester 3 : Starts September to late November


Programs :

  • Ph.D - Typically takes 3 to 5 years
  • Masters (Research/Thesis-based) - Typically 2 years
  • Master (Coursework) - 1 year to 2 years
  • Bachelors - Typically 3 years / Bachelors (Honours) - 4 years
  • Diploma - Typically 2 years


General Admission Criteria

  • Universities accept both 15 years and 16 years of education
  • Ideally the percentage must be a min of 60% and above. However, the exception is some universities accept 55% and above and backlogs (unsuccessful attempts/fails) to the tune to 10 to 15 (university and program specific this is)
  • Language proficiency : The most common tests are IELTS/PTE and TOEFL
  • SOP is a must for all the universities at the time of admission
  • Evidence of employment, internship credentials, vendor certifications and cv, if you have to be submitted at the time to application to university

What are the Requirements to Study in Australia ?

Apart from a minimum of 60% in grade 12, you will need a score of at least 5.5 in IELTS. The TOEFL internet score should be 55 and the PTE score should be between 42 and 49. Remember that these tests should be taken not more than two years before your course commencement.

To do a Bachelor's degree in Australia, you require at least 65% in your grade 12. In addition, the IELTS score should be at least 6.0, the TOEFL score should be 65, and the PTE score should be between 50 and 57.

A 3-year degree from a recognized university is enough for most universities. However, specific courses and universities demand a qualification equivalent to an Australian Bachelor's degree. The IELTS, TOEFL, and PTE scores should be 6.5, 79, and 58-64, respectively.

A three-to-four-year Bachelor's degree and a two-year Master's degree are essential for doing a Doctoral degree in Australia. Added to it, a minimum IELTS score of 6.5 is also required.


What is the Entrance Exam to Study in Australia ?

A candidate needs to take the International English Language Testing System (IELTS) test to gain admission to any university in Australia. This tests the English language skills and has four components: reading, writing, listening, and speaking. The test should be completed within 2 hours and 45 minutes with a minimum score of 6 or 6.5.

The Test Of English as a Foreign Language (TOEFL) can be taken in two forms; paper-based (PBT) or internet-based (iBT). An iBT score of at least 79 or a PBT score of at least 550 will be required to be accepted into an Australian university.

The Pearson Test of English (PTE) is yet another test that checks the English proficiency of a student. You should have a minimum score of 50 in this three-hour-long test to get admission into an Australian university.

The Cambridge English : Advanced (CAE) test is organized by Cambridge University and is recognized by universities all over Australia. You should have a minimum score of 180 on this three-hour test.

Australia Student Visa

An Australian student visa permits you to live, study and work in Australia for up to 5 years. During their studies, in two weeks they can work 40 hours and unlimited work during semester breaks. Plus, they don't have to wait for classes to start. The basic Australian visa requirements are :

  • All your academics that are used in support for an admission to an Australian university
  • Proof of enrolment (eCOE - Electronic Confirmation of Enrolment)
  • Visa application fee
  • Proof of health examination
  • Proof of English proficiency
  • Proof of funds to establish that you can meet the tuition fee and living expenses without having to work while study
  • Genuine Temporary Entrant statement
  • Statement of purpose demonstrating how the chosen program will help you meet your academic needs and career goals
  • Any internship or experience documents, if you have
  • Passport with a minimum one-year validity from the date of intake commencement
